How to Remove the Battery from a Mercedes Car Key?
1 Answers
Here is the method for removing the battery from a Mercedes car key: 1. From the end of the key, push up the marked switch, and the hidden mechanical key will pop out slightly, allowing you to remove the mechanical key. 2. Use the mechanical key you just removed to press against the marked position, apply a slight force, and the key casing will open. 3. After opening the key casing, you will find the battery located deep inside; gently pry it out with a small card to remove the old battery. Additional Information: 1. After installing the new battery, ensure the positive and negative poles are correctly aligned. Then proceed with the installation steps: first insert the top of the casing, then press firmly on the other end to complete the battery replacement. Don't forget to reinsert the mechanical key. 2. If the remote key gets wet, avoid shaking it vigorously or pressing any buttons, as this can cause water to seep into other critical circuits. Also, do not immediately use the remote to unlock the car, as this may damage the circuit board. The correct approach is to open the key casing, lay it flat, and use a hairdryer to dry it before further inspection.
